How much do internship literary agent reader j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 12, 2026, the average hourly pay for internship literary agent reader in the United States is $17.44,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.38 and $19.23 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What will you do as an Enforcement Agent?

  • Patrol designated area on foot, to identify vehicles without proper payment or permission
  • Enforce location requirements by issuing citations in violation of parking rules
  • Conduct lot audits and car counts at designated locations and times
  • Record and enter data collected for violations in the approved system
  • Immediately report incidents, accidents, or safety concerns to management
  • Utilize excellent time management and report writing skills
  • Monitor condition of equipment and notify management of malfunctions and repair needs
  • Communicate with professionalism in all interactions with customers, clients, and coworkers
